How to trace a phone number
- Answer the phone or check the caller ID to see if it's a call you want to trace.
- After you have hung up, or after the call has stopped ringing, pick up the phone again and listen for a dial tone.
- Dial *57.
- You will receive a recorded message with additional instructions for you to follow.

Herein, how long does it take for a call to be traced?
As soon as a call is made on a landline, the phone company can track and trace it immediately. This has been the case since the mid-1980s, when the introduction of electronic switching systems replaced automatic electro-mechanical switching systems, such as the crossbar-switching system.

Can 911 track your call?
Historically, 911 dispatchers have been unable to track the locations of callers on cell phones as accurately as those calling from landlines. This location information must be available for at least 50% of wireless 911 calls, a requirement which increases to 70% in 2020.Can a phone call be traced to a location?
They can't hide it from the phone company. The location of a cell phone caller is equally easy to trace, thanks to a 2006 order by the Federal Communications Commission that requires cell phone networks to feature location-tracking technology such as GPS chips to assist 911 services.Can police track your phone calls?

On a per-call basis, you can't beat *67 at hiding your number. This trick works for smartphones and landlines. The free process hides your number, which will show up on the other end as “Private” or “Blocked” when reading on caller ID. You will have to dial *67 each time you want your number blocked.What does * 69 mean on the phone?
